WebShang, along with other ancient Chinese cities, had two city walls—one inner and one outer wall. The common residents could live within the outer wall, but could not go past the inner wall, which enclosed a temple area, …
WebThe ancient Chinese had lived in primitive villages, and were mainly farmers or hunters.
